Antes de explicar tecnicamente, gosto de fazer uma analogia de uma situação real que já passamos para entender melhor.
Imagine você na beira de um fogão, é isso mesmo que você tá pensando, um fogão simples, desses de 4 bocas e um forno.
Se uma das 4 bocas parar, você ainda tem 3 bocas para fritar o ovo, se parar duas, ainda terá duas, caso para 3, terá uma e se, para as 4, aí sim você tá lascado!
Agora trazendo pro ramo da computação, se você tem um equipamento com mais de uma forma de comunicação (placa de rede ethernet, Wifi,Bluetooth), você pode criar uma interface loopback!
ta blz Glauco, explica aí o que é essa tal interface loopback!?
Uma interface loopback é uma interface de rede virtual em um dispositivo de computação. Em sistemas operacionais, como o Linux, Windows e outros, a interface loopback é geralmente representada pelo endereço IP 127.0.0.1. Esse endereço IP é conhecido como o endereço de loopback ou localhost.
A principal finalidade da interface loopback é permitir a comunicação do dispositivo consigo mesmo. Quando um programa ou serviço em um dispositivo envia dados para a interface loopback, esses dados são roteados internamente sem passar por uma rede física.
Isso é útil para testar a conectividade de rede local, diagnosticar problemas de rede ou desenvolver e testar software sem depender de uma rede real.
A interface loopback é frequentemente usada para verificar se a pilha de protocolos TCP/IP está funcionando corretamente em um dispositivo.
Pode ser acessada por aplicativos e serviços locais como se estivessem se comunicando com outros dispositivos em uma rede, mas, na realidade, estão apenas se comunicando consigo mesmos através da interface loopback.
Em resumo, a interface loopback é uma ferramenta útil para testar e diagnosticar a conectividade de rede em um dispositivo, especialmente durante o desenvolvimento e a depuração de software.